How many times greater is 3 x 10^4 than 3 x 10^1

Answer:

1000 times greater

Explanation:

Divide the largest number by the smaller


(3*10^(4) )/(3*10^(1) ) =1*10^(4-1) =1*10^(3) =1*1000=1000
